Is 33 719 445 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 33 719 445 is about 5 806.845.

Thus, the square root of 33 719 445 is not an integer, and therefore 33 719 445 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 33 719 445?

The square of a number (here 33 719 445) is the result of the product of this number (33 719 445) by itself (i.e., 33 719 445 × 33 719 445); the square of 33 719 445 is sometimes called "raising 33 719 445 to the power 2", or "33 719 445 squared".

The square of 33 719 445 is 1 137 000 971 108 025 because 33 719 445 × 33 719 445 = 33 719 4452 = 1 137 000 971 108 025.

As a consequence, 33 719 445 is the square root of 1 137 000 971 108 025.
